The College of Coastal Georgia Archives

The College of Coastal Georgia Archives is the repository for the records of the College that have continuing and enduring value relating to the institution's history. This research guide has information on the Archives' holdings, which includes but is not limited to presidential papers, photographs, department records and college publications (course catalogs, yearbooks, student newspapers, etc.).

 

The Special Collections

The Special Collection's holdings include books regarding regional, state and national history, as well as a few comic book collections. There are also some older and rare books that were once part of the library's main collection.

Make an Appointment

The College Archives & Special Collections Reading Room is open by appointment only during open hours at Gould Memorial Library on the Brunswick campus of the College of Coastal Georgia. Appointments can be made in two hour increments. 

Some documents and publications are digitized and available online in our Coastal Scholar Repository. There are also links to some digitized materials found in our College Publications Research Guide (see tab above).

Donations

Due to limited space, if you would like to donate materials to the College Archives and Special Collections, please first contact our Special Collections Librarian or the Dean of the Library to see if there is room for us to take on your collection and/or item(s) you wish to donate.

If and when approval has been received, donors will then need to reach out to the Advancement Office to complete the appropriate paperwork before bringing the materials to campus.

Please do not drop off materials at the Gould Memorial Library, the Advancement Office, or anyone else affiliated with the College of Coastal Georgia. The appropriate paperwork must be completed before the College of Coastal Georgia Archives and Special Collections will consider accepting donations.
